NOTE

Each country controls its local time offset and the use of summer time, and so they are subject to change.

Removing the battery from the camera too soon after configuring time and date settings for the first time can cause the settings to be reset to their factory defaults. Do not remove the battery for at least 24 hours after configuring settings.
